linuxmdk3命令
-
Linux mdk3命令是一种用于无线网络攻击和测试的工具。它可以用于测试网络的安全性,检测潜在的弱点,并进行网络性能和带宽测试。mdk3命令通常用于网络管理员、安全专家和研究人员来评估无线网络的安全性。下面将详细介绍一些常用的mdk3命令及其用法。
1. mdk3 wlan0mon b -c 1: 在无线接口wlan0mon上启动Beacon Flooding攻击,使用信道1来传播伪造的网络Beacon帧。这种攻击会引起附近无线设备的连接问题,并干扰真实网络的正常运行。
2. mdk3 wlan0mon a -a MAC地址 -m: 在无线接口wlan0mon上启动认证攻击,伪造一个指定MAC地址的网络访问点,并等待其他设备连接。这种攻击可以用来获取其他设备的敏感信息,如密码和账户信息。
3. mdk3 wlan0mon d -b SSID名字 -m: 在无线接口wlan0mon上启动退避攻击,向指定的SSID广播退避帧,迫使连接到该网络的设备断开连接。这种攻击可以用来阻止其他设备在特定的无线网络中进行通信。
4. mdk3 wlan0mon p -t 目标MAC地址 -j -n: 在无线接口wlan0mon上启动无线干扰攻击,将指定的目标设备的数据包发送到无效的无线网络中,以阻止其正常通信。这种攻击可以用来打断目标设备的网络连接。
除了上述几个常用的mdk3命令,还有一些其他的命令选项可以进一步定制攻击和测试行为。不过需要注意的是,mdk3命令是一种网络攻击工具,仅用于合法的安全测试目的。未经授权的使用可能涉及违法行为。在使用mdk3命令时,请务必遵守当地法律法规,并获得相关授权。
2年前 -
Linux的mdk3命令是一种用于网络攻击和测试的工具,常用于无线网络中的压力测试与干扰攻击。mdk3是一款强大的无线网络攻击工具,具有多种功能和选项。
1. DOS(拒绝服务)攻击: mdk3可以用于对无线网络进行DOS攻击,通过向无线接入点发送大量的无效数据包,导致无线网络变得不可用。这种攻击方式可以让无线网络无法正常使用,迫使用户断开连接。
2. 收集信息: mdk3可以通过扫描附近的无线网络,收集网络信息。它可以识别无线接入点的SSID(无线网络名称)、BSSID(接入点的MAC地址)、通道、加密方式等。这些信息对于网络管理员和安全测试人员很有用,可以用于评估无线网络的安全性。
3. 攻击WPA加密: mdk3可以用于攻击WPA加密的无线网络。它可以在短时间内尝试多种攻击方式,如暴力破解、字典攻击等,以获取WPA密码。这对于有权限的渗透测试和安全评估非常有用。
4. 干扰无线网络: mdk3可以通过发送大量的无效数据包、干扰信号等方式,对无线网络进行干扰。这种干扰会导致无线网络的速度变慢、连接不稳定等问题。这种功能可以用于评估无线网络的鲁棒性和应对干扰的能力。
5. 测试无线网络的容量: mdk3可以用来测试无线网络的容量和性能。通过向无线网络发送大量的数据包,可以模拟真实的网络流量,从而测试无线网络的性能和带宽。这对于网络管理员和网络规划师来说是非常重要的,可以帮助他们优化无线网络的性能和容量。
需要注意的是,mdk3是一款强大的工具,但它也可以被滥用。使用mdk3需要遵守法律法规,并获得相关网络所有者的许可。未经授权的使用可能会触犯法律,并对网络安全造成严重的风险。
2年前 -
MDK3(又名Murder Death Kill 3)是一款用于无线网络攻击的工具,它可以通过向目标网络发送大量的无线数据包来干扰和禁用目标网络的正常运行。MDK3通常用于测试网络的安全性,帮助系统管理员发现网络中可能存在的漏洞。在本文中,我们将详细介绍使用MDK3命令进行无线攻击的方法和操作流程。
## 安装MDK3工具
首先,我们需要安装MDK3工具。在大多数Linux发行版中,可以使用apt、yum或者dnf等包管理器来安装MDK3。在Debian或者Ubuntu系统中,可以通过以下命令来安装MDK3:
“`
sudo apt-get install mdk3
“`在CentOS或者Fedora系统中,可以通过以下命令来安装MDK3:
“`
sudo yum install mdk3
“`## 使用MDK3进行无线攻击
安装完成后,我们可以使用MDK3命令进行各种无线攻击。以下是MDK3的一些常用命令和操作流程。### 扫描无线网络
在进行无线攻击之前,我们需要先扫描附近的无线网络,以获取目标网络的信息。可以使用以下命令来扫描无线网络:
“`
sudo mdk3 <无线网卡名称> scan
“`
这里的`<无线网卡名称>`是你的无线网卡设备名称,可以通过`ifconfig`命令来查看。### 发送Deauthentication攻击
Deauthentication攻击是一种常见的无线攻击手法,它可以使目标设备断开与无线网络的连接。可以使用以下命令来发送Deauthentication攻击:
“`
sudo mdk3 <无线网卡名称> d <目标网络MAC地址>
“`
这里的`<无线网卡名称>`是你的无线网卡设备名称,`<目标网络MAC地址>`是目标无线网络的MAC地址。### 发送Beacon Flood攻击
Beacon Flood攻击是一种向目标网络发送大量的Beacon帧的攻击手法,可以使目标网络被大量的虚假网络信息淹没。可以使用以下命令来发送Beacon Flood攻击:
“`
sudo mdk3 <无线网卡名称> b -n-d <目标无线网络的ESSID>
“`
这里的`<无线网卡名称>`是你的无线网卡设备名称,``是要发送的Beacon帧的数量,`<目标无线网络的ESSID>`是目标无线网络的名称。 ### 发送Probe Request攻击
Probe Request攻击是一种向目标设备发送大量Probe Request消息的攻击手法,可以使目标设备耗尽资源。可以使用以下命令来发送Probe Request攻击:
“`
sudo mdk3 <无线网卡名称> p -t <目标无线网络的MAC地址> -d <目标无线网络的ESSID>
“`
这里的`<无线网卡名称>`是你的无线网卡设备名称,`<目标无线网络的MAC地址>`是目标无线网络的MAC地址,`<目标无线网络的ESSID>`是目标无线网络的名称。### 发送Authentication Attack攻击
Authentication Attack攻击是一种向目标设备发送大量Authentication请求的攻击手法,可以使目标设备耗尽资源。可以使用以下命令来发送Authentication Attack攻击:
“`
sudo mdk3 <无线网卡名称> a -b <目标无线网络的MAC地址> -s <源MAC地址>
“`
这里的`<无线网卡名称>`是你的无线网卡设备名称,`<目标无线网络的MAC地址>`是目标无线网络的MAC地址,`<源MAC地址>`是源MAC地址。## 总结
MDK3是一款用于无线网络攻击的工具,可以帮助系统管理员测试网络的安全性。在本文中,我们介绍了安装MDK3工具的方法,并详细讲解了使用MDK3命令进行无线攻击的方法和操作流程。请在合法的环境下使用MDK3工具,切勿用于非法用途。2年前